Tottenham Hotspur crowned most profitable club as every Premier League team’s finances revealed

Tottenham Hotspur has been named the most profitable club in the Premier League, leading a list that compares every team’s finances. While Spurs take first place, one of their high-profile rivals finds itself at the other end of these rankings.

How Tottenham Rose to the Top

Tottenham Hotspur has officially been crowned the most profitable Premier League club in new financial data, as reported by Fourfourtwo. The north London side’s leading position underscores its successful operations off the pitch, reinforced by modern infrastructure and a strong global appeal.

What This Means for the Future

While finances do not guarantee results on the pitch, a club’s profitability often influences its long-term ambitions. Consistent earnings can translate into better facilities, more robust youth development, and strategic signings, all of which can have a ripple effect on future performance.
